I just put a cam (crazy jay) in an 03 2500 5.7 4wd last weekend. It ran off superchips just fine. But with you having an 03, SC is the best tuner you can get. Dont get the SC3865, get the SC3815. The SC3865 is a waste of money for you.

Make you own powerwire ($10). Make you own CAI ($40-60). With an 03, pull your TMR wire (free). Get an electric fan and controller ($75).

All those are cheap easy mods.
